Leica V-Lux 40 vs Panasonic ZS45 Overview

Let's look more in depth at the Leica V-Lux 40 and Panasonic ZS45, both Small Sensor Superzoom cameras by manufacturers Leica and Panasonic. The image resolution of the V-Lux 40 (14MP) and the ZS45 (16MP) is pretty close and both cameras posses the identical sensor sizing (1/2.3").

Leica V-Lux 40 vs Panasonic ZS45 Physical Comparison

When you are going to lug around your camera frequently, you'll have to take into account its weight and volume. The Leica V-Lux 40 comes with outside dimensions of 105mm x 59mm x 28mm (4.1" x 2.3" x 1.1") and a weight of 210 grams (0.46 lbs) while the Panasonic ZS45 has sizing of 108mm x 60mm x 32mm (4.3" x 2.4" x 1.3") accompanied by a weight of 249 grams (0.55 lbs).

Leica V-Lux 40 vs Panasonic ZS45 Sensor Comparison

Sometimes, it can be difficult to see the difference in sensor measurements just by looking through specs. The graphic here should offer you a far better sense of the sensor sizes in the V-Lux 40 and ZS45.

All in all, both of the cameras feature the identical sensor size albeit not the same megapixels. You can expect the Panasonic ZS45 to render more detail using its extra 2MP. Higher resolution will also help you crop shots way more aggressively. The older V-Lux 40 will be behind in sensor innovation.
